VI. Consider Development Proposals for Old Clinic Site Lot
Development proposals from GC Real Estate Partners, Titanium Partners and Ebert
Construction were reviewed.
• GC Real Estate Partners is proposing a $17.2 million, 79-unit apartment project; requesting
about $2 million in public assistance.
• Titanium Partners is proposing a $21 million 40-unit CO-OP housing project; seeking $2
million in public assistance,
• Ebert Companies is proposing an $11.5 million 64-unit apartment project and is seeking
about $3 million of public assistance.
■ Discussion of public assistance options (TIF, tax abatement, etc.)
■ All three proposals are aiming for a 2025 construction start.
■ Discussion
M/S/P: Czmowski, Block to invite all three developers to present before a joint meeting of the
EDA Board and Finance Team. Passed unanimously.
VII. Business Prospect for Lot 1140
A cannabis testing company has indicated an interest in building a new 10,000 sf lab facility in
Hutchinson. Employment would be potentially 30-40 comprised of lab technicians, chemists,
etc. Essentially it would be same as food safety testing, but specifically for cannabis products.
The EDA has $52,967 invested in the lot putting in the stormwater pond and driveway.
M/S/P: Block, May to authorize sale of the lot at our standard industrial park lot pricing of$1 per
square foot ($78,277). Passed unanimously.
Staff will get this organized.
VIII. Preliminary discussion of potential loan for Smoky Dukes Pretzels.
Discussion of a potential loan for Smoky Dukes; needed to make leasehold improvements at
the Enterprise Center.
• This business is a true start-up
• Company is finalizing its business plan with assistance from Pam Lehman at SBDC
• About $152,000 in leasehold improvements are needed (separate room w/air
exchange system, conversion of existing break room into a cleaning room, etc.)
• Company is aiming for an early Q1 start up
• Discussion
A loan review committee comprised of Mike Cannon, Anthony Hanson and Josh Laffen was
established. No formal action was taken.
